Cost of Attendance at Beal University

For academic year 2023-2024, the tuition & fees for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se, which is the largest program at Beal University, is $42,305. The Living costs besides the tuition & fees are reported as $66,080 when a student lives off campus.The average financial amount that students have received is $4,567 and after receiving the aid, the total costs of attendance at Beal is $111,385.
